. The Society came to the USA around 1845. No work of charity is foreign to the Society. This includes any form of help that alleviates suffering or deprivation and promotes human dignity and personal integrity. The Society serves those in need regardless of race, religion, creed, ethnic or social background, gender, or political opinions.
Organized locally, Vincentians (as our members are called) witness God’s love by embracing all works of charity and justice. The Society collaborates with other people and organizations of good will in relieving need and addressing its causes, to attempt systemic change.
